Dominic James and Tom Crean To Be Honored At Halftime Sunday
« on: January 21, 2022, 02:17:31 PM »
Marquette will honor its 2022 M Club Hall of Fame class, which includes former head coach Tom Crean and guard Dominic James, during a special halftime presentation.

Here's some Dom highlights to enjoy:

2-25-2006 - Putback dunk versus Notre Dame
https://twitter.com/MUOverload/status/1484586592622759942?s=20

3-1-2006 - Buzzer beating three sends takes Louisville to overtime
https://twitter.com/MUOverload/status/1484556401624027141?s=20

11-27-2006 - Score last 18 points for MU including game winning three at Valpo
https://twitter.com/MUOverload/status/1394650775985565699?s=20

12-16-2008 - Blocks 6'7" Tennessee player at rim
https://twitter.com/MUOverload/status/1484601697569755144?s=20

12-22-2008 - Game winning three at NC State

The Big East added South Florida in that round of expansion, too.  Marquette made the Final 4 in 2003 and crapped out in ‘04 and ‘05. 

Not a shot at Crean.  The Big East was adding Marquette to alleviate the concerns of the basketball centric schools along with DePaul.  The other 3 additions in that round were basketball/football schools.  Even though they were better hoops schools, they brought football.

Crean made the transition easier by having Marquette prepared with better facilities and upgrading the talent.
